The Expanding Workflow Automation Market

The global workflow automation market is projected to reach $78.81 billion by 2030, growing at a remarkable comp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 23.68% from 2022 to 2030. This rapid growth highlights the increasing adoption of automation technologies across various industries. The benefits of automation are becoming more apparent as organizations worldwide seek to enhance their operational efficiency and competitiveness.

Cost Reduction and Efficiency Gains

Organizations that implement automation can achieve up to 40% cost reduction in certain processes, according to Automation Anywhere. This significant cost saving is a primary driver for the widespread adoption of automation technologies. Companies have reported impressive savings through automation, including a $19 million reduction in provisioning costs, an 85% reduction in recruitment hours, and $120 million saved from automated operations, with projections exceeding $1 billion in savings by year-end.

Increasing Adoption of Automation Technologies

The adoption of automation technologies is rapidly increasing, with 73% of organizations worldwide now using automation, up from 58% in 2019, as noted by Deloitte. This surge in adoption is driven by the clear advantages that automation offers, such as enhanced productivity, reduced errors, and improved decision-making capabilities. As more organizations recognize these benefits, the trend towards automation is expected to continue growing.

Key Benefits of AI in Workflow Automation

Increased Efficiency and Productivity: AI-powered workflow automation significantly boosts efficiency and productivity by automating repetitive tasks and allowing employees to focus on more strategic activities.

Reduced Errors and Improved Quality: Automated systems reduce the likelihood of human errors, ensuring higher quality and accuracy in processes.

Enhanced Decision-Making Capabilities: AI enables better decision-making by analyzing large volumes of data quickly and accurately, providing valuable insights for business strategies.

Improved Customer Service and Satisfaction: Automation enhances customer service by enabling faster response times and more efficient handling of customer inquiries and issues.

Better Compliance and Risk Management: Automated systems help ensure compliance with regulatory requirements and improve risk management by maintaining accurate and up-to-date records.

Scalability for Business Growth: Automation technologies can easily scale to accommodate business growth, allowing organizations to handle increased workloads without significant additional resources.

Implementing AI in Workflow Automation

Identify Key Processes: Start by identifying repetitive tasks and processes that would benefit most from automation. This initial step is crucial for maximizing the impact of automation.

Start Small: Begin with small, manageable projects to demonstrate the value of automation. This approach helps build confidence and understanding of the technology among employees.

Leverage AI-Powered Tools: Utilize AI-powered tools for process discovery and optimization. These tools can help identify inefficiencies and areas for improvement.

Ensure Proper Training: Provide comprehensive training for employees on how to use new automated systems. This reduces resistance to change and ensures that employees can effectively utilize the technology.

Continuous Improvement: Regularly review and optimize automated processes to ensure they remain efficient and relevant. Continuous improvement is key to sustaining the benefits of automation.

Ethical Considerations: Consider the ethical implications of AI implementation, such as data privacy and algorithmic bias. Ensure that your automation tools comply with relevant privacy laws and ethical guidelines.

Key AI Technologies in Workflow Automation

Machine Learning (ML): Machine learning is used to detect anomalies, reroute processes, trigger new processes, and make action recommendations. It plays a critical role in enhancing the capabilities of automated systems.

Natural Language Processing (NLP): NLP enables chatbots to interpret user questions and automate responses, improving customer interactions and service efficiency.

AI Agents: Custom AI agents can be built for cognitive tasks and embedded in automation workflows, providing advanced automation capabilities for complex processes.

Challenges to Consider

Initial Implementation Costs: The upfront costs of implementing automation technologies can be substantial. However, the long-term savings and efficiency gains often justify the initial investment.

Potential Disruption to Existing Processes: Automation can disrupt existing workflows, requiring time and effort to adapt and integrate new systems.

Integration Challenges: Integrating new automated systems with existing technologies and processes can be challenging. Ensuring compatibility and seamless integration is crucial for success.

Employee Resistance to Change: Resistance to change is a common challenge when implementing new technologies. Addressing employee concerns and providing adequate training can help mitigate this issue.

Ongoing Maintenance and Updates: Automated systems require ongoing maintenance and updates to remain effective and secure. Regularly reviewing and optimizing these systems is essential for sustaining their benefits.
